Top Playground Par Llc | Reviews & Ratings | vimarsana.com

Playground par llc in India - 246174/ near srinagar/ near pauri-garhwal

Playground par llc in India - 246131/ near kulsera/ near pauri-garhwal

Playground par llc in India - 212507/ near kaushambi